Advice for exchange programs – incoming and outgoing
Our office hours
We provide advice for FAU students on spending time studying or doing an internship abroad (“outgoing students”) and support international students who are studying at FAU as part of a stay abroad (“incoming students”). We also provide international degree-seeking students with expert advice on all non-academic topics (for instance on financing studies, health insurance or matters concerning residency).
In person and online
Our office hours vary depending on target group:
Advice on studying abroad (outgoing)
In person: Thursday from 9 am to 11 am
Visiting address: Room 2.4942 (2nd floor), Freyeslebenstraße 1, 91058 Erlangen
Online: Monday and Thursday, from 9 am – 11 am via Zoom.
Advice for “outgoing” students is for students at FAU who are planning to study or complete an internship abroad. We cover topics such as the application process, funding opportunities and necessary preparations and help students prepare for spending time abroad.
Advice for students interested in coming to FAU on an exchange (“incoming students”)
In person: Thursday from 9 am to 11 am
Visiting address: Room 2.4942 (2nd floor), Freyeslebenstraße 1, 91058 Erlangen
Online: Monday and Thursday, from 9 am – 11 am via Zoom
Support for international students on all organizational matters before and during their stay of one to two semesters as part of an exchange program or coming to FAU as a free mover. The aim is to help them get off to a flying start and make it easier for them to find their feet at university.
Advice for regular international students (non-academic matters)
In person: Thursday from 9 am to 12 noon
Visiting address: Room 2.4842 (2nd floor), Freyeslebenstraße 1, 91058 Erlangen
Online: Monday and Wednesday, from 9 am – 12 noon via Zoom\
Advice on non-academic topics (for example, financing your studies, health insurance and residency) for international students at FAU aiming for a German university degree who have successfully applied for and are now enrolled on one of our more than 150 degree programs.
